Porter Robinson's SHELTER: Behind The Scenes with Crunchyroll

Published 2016-10-20
Crunchyroll teamed up with Porter Robinson and A-1 Pictures to create an original anime for the music video for SHELTER. The behind-the-scenes follows Porter through the creative process of bringing this animation to life working with writers, artists and actors in Japan.
